Mind on the Court: How Los Angeles Locals Are Turning Tennis into a Form of Therapy

In Los Angeles, where ambition runs high and the pace of life rarely slows, people are finding unexpected ways to restore balance. One growing trend across the city is “tennis therapy,” a movement that blends the physical benefits of sport with the emotional rewards of mindfulness. More Angelenos are picking up rackets not just for competition but for peace of mind, using tennis as a tool to manage stress, anxiety, and depression. The Healing Power of Movement Physical activity has long been linked to mental health, but tennis stands out because it engages both mind and body. Every serve, rally, and return demands concentration, forcing players to stay in the moment. This intense focus can quiet racing thoughts, much like meditation. For many Los Angeles residents juggling work, social life, and personal challenges, this focus offers a much-needed mental reset. The Digital Media Revolution and Its Impact on Los Angeles Entertainment Jobs

Los Angeles has always been a city of reinvention. Known globally as the birthplace of Hollywood , it has witnessed the transition from silent films to talkies, from black-and-white television to color broadcasting, and from traditional cinema to cable television. Now, in the twenty-first century, digital media has ushered in a new era of transformation. The way entertainment is created, distributed, and consumed has changed dramatically, and with it, the nature of work in Los Angeles’ entertainment industry. As digital platforms grow in influence, jobs across film, television, music, gaming, and social media have undergone seismic shifts. This revolution has sparked new opportunities for creative and technical professionals while also raising challenges related to job stability, labor rights, and global competition.
